Making A Functional Mobile Office

You are here:

Many business owners have to work on the go due to the nature of their jobs. This is particularly true for window cleaners because they are constantly driving to a job site or to bid on future contracts. In order to keep your business alive and thriving, you need an office that can travel with you. Here are some tips for making a functional mobile office so you can be productive wherever you go.

Get A Power Inverter

A power inverter will turn your vehicle’s power outlet into a traditional plug. You can use this to charge your phone, your laptop, your tablet, or any other electrical device you use. Power inverters are very inexpensive, and they make working on the go a lot easier. You never have to worry about your battery going low on the road.

Find An Internet Source

There are several ways to get internet while you’re traveling for work. You can activate the hotspot on your smartphone and use it like a wireless router in your car. This will use data on your phone plan though, so you want to make sure you have a plan large enough to support your needs. You could also get a “MiFi” device, which provides the same service on a separate unit. You will pay for a data plan connected to the MiFi box, and then you can use it like any other wireless router.

If you are parked somewhere and working, try getting on a nearby Wi-Fi network. Many restaurants and big retailers offer free Wi-Fi nowadays because it is in such popular demand. Using these alternatives will save you from eating up your monthly data allowance.

Install A Drop-In Cash Safe Below Your Seat

If you have to keep cash in your car, make sure it is well protected. Getting a drop-in safe is the best option because it does not require you to physically open the door for deposits. No one can see how much money you’re actually carrying, so you’re not an instant target for robbers. If you do lose money in a robbery, it will only be whatever you have in your hands – not what you have in the entire safe. Deposit the money at the bank at different times throughout the day to reduce your risks even further.

Get A Portable Lap Desk

A portable lap desk is exactly what it sounds like – a desk made to sit on your lap. This is convenient for propping up your computer, writing on documents, signing paperwork, and doing other work-related tasks. You may be able to use your center console for some of these duties, but it may not be the best surface to write on. With a lap desk, you can create a tray on your legs while you work and then just store it in the back when you’re finished.

Don’t Work And Drive

In order to maximize your time management, you may be tempted to work while you drive. This is dangerous, not only for you but for other people on the road. If you have to make a phone call, use the Bluetooth in your car. If you need to send a text or email, wait ’til you are pulled over and parked before completing that action. No business transaction is worth risking your safety…EVER.
